What are Hi-Index lenses for Spectacle glasses, and how do I know if I need them?

0

Having thinner, lighter prescription lenses with a higher index of refraction is the ideal lens for any prescription which requires 4 or more diopters of correction. High index spectacle lenses can accomplish this for a more stylish look and comfortable feel of your new pair of spectacles. Please note that if you need contact lenses for your Keratoconus to correct your vision adequately, spectacles will not give you the same. However if you wear spectacles for your Keratoconus and they do correct your vision adequately (which usually means that your Keratoconus is mild) then you may benefit from Hi-Index lenses.
